Oklahoma City Thunder forward Jalen Williams is set to rejoin the lineup for Monday’s matchup against the Philadelphia 76ers. He has been sidelined since February 11 due to a hamstring strain.
Williams’ season has been heavily disrupted by injuries. He sat out the first 19 games while recovering from wrist surgery in the offseason. Then, in mid-January, he dealt with his initial hamstring strain.
After briefly returning for two games, he suffered another setback and has since missed the Thunder’s last 16 contests.
In total, Williams has played just 26 games this season. The Oklahoma City Thunder have posted a 38-7 record without him and 19-7 in the games he has appeared in.
